With a wide range of cosmetic products on the market, it can be a challenge to identify the ones that are really good quality and suitable for your skin. It is important to choose products that not only meet your aesthetic expectations, but are also safe and effective. We have researched how you can recognize quality cosmetic products.
Checking ingredients
Ingredients are the key to understanding the quality of a cosmetic product. Avoid products with harmful or irritating ingredients such as parabens, sulfates and artificial fragrance. Instead, look for products with active ingredients that are proven to work, such as hyaluronic acid, vitamins and natural extracts.Brand transparency
Quality cosmetic brands are usually transparent about their ingredients, origins and manufacturing practices. Check whether the brand provides detailed information about its products and whether this information is easily accessible to consumers.Certificates and approvals
Look for products that have certifications such as Ecocert, USDA Organic, or Leaping Bunny, which ensure that the products are safe, ethically grown, and environmentally friendly. Dermatologist approvals are also important, especially for products for sensitive skin.Packaging and preservatives
The quality of the packaging can affect the effectiveness and safety of the product. The packaging must protect the product from contamination and must not contain harmful chemicals. Preservatives are also important, ensuring long-lasting product freshness without harming the skin.User opinions and ratings
Read reviews and opinions from other users. Real experiences of people who have already used the product can give you a good insight into the effectiveness and possible side effects.Price and quality
A higher price does not always mean higher quality. However, quality products are often more expensive due to the use of better ingredients and more advanced production processes. Consider the relationship between price and quality.Product testing
If possible, try the product before buying. Many stores offer testers that allow you to see how the product behaves on your skin.Recognizing quality cosmetic products requires attention and understanding. By checking ingredients, studying brand transparency, considering certifications and approvals, analyzing packaging and preservatives, reading reviews from other users, and testing products, you can choose products that are safe, effective, and suitable for your skin.
